Transaction 33bcad77f86205c0de6e545dec887399fdd9574634b581f3034a0e6f82edaa82
1 Input
1 Output
-
33bcad77f86205c0de6e545dec887399fdd9574634b581f3034a0e6f82edaa82:0
- value
- 1390
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 de2acea754485454e7ecbd727b61ce848abd620a OP_EQUAL
- address
- 3MwjDRrYPZzcZP6EqBshudJj1v5B8k2Zif